The Wretched Tortured Cultists troopers 3D models come pre-supported (STL and Chitubox files), with unsupported files too.It includes:- 3 different Wretched ones (each with a censored and bare chested variation, the masked one has a full and half mask variation too).- 25 mm base !!Be careful with the pointy bits, they can poke you!!
